Pittiplatsch 2 Posted November 12, 2018 Share Posted November 12, 2018 Hi, I've trouble with the Web Player of Emby. With some media the player is stopping playback near the end of a media file. The video screen goes black, no audio anymore. The UI still works. My files are mkv's with h264, vobsub subtitles and aac audio. Usually it doesn't help restarting the media and jumping to the position. The playback will stop again after a similar playback position is reached. Sometimes it helps avoiding transcoding by deactivating subtitles, but sometimes this isn't helping either. It usually happens when the playback has coming to around 90 percent of the media file and when media files have a running time around 40 minutes in total. It doesn't happened with media longer than that yet, but this might be a coincidence. This issue isn't appearing with every media, it's difficult to reproduce it at the moment. Playing back affected media with something like VLC isn't causing any issues so far. It sounds a bit like here, besides this user is playing back avi's instead mkv's: https://emby.media/community/index.php?/topic/64322-playback-stopping-prematurely/?hl=%2Bstop+%2Bplayback I'm running Emby 3.5.2.0 on Docker/Linux. I'm using Firefox, but also tested it with Chrome, same here. I also attached some logs, there is a exception logged also, see end of embyserver.txt.
